MiR-34a induces cellular dysfunction under hyperglycaemia of MSCs by regulating SIRT1-FoxO3a autophagy dynamics. MSCs were cultured with normal or high glucose medium for 28 days with or without transfection with miR-34a inhibitor or siRNA-SIRT1 for 48 h, respectively. a The protein expression were determined by western blot. b Cellular senescence was analysed by SA-β-gal staining. c Expression of VEGF and bFGF were measured by ELISA. Each column represents mean ± SD from three independent experiments. *P < 0.05 vs. NG, #P < 0.05 vs. miR-34a I group
